What to check before for buildings with low open violation rates near transit in City Line

  • Expect a tighter shortlist: “low open violations” filters for buildings with fewer open issues in public records, and “near transit” focuses on practical commuting distance.
  • Before applying, confirm the current rent, lease start date, and what’s included (utilities, laundry, storage). Then ask how long any work orders have been open.
  • When possible, match the building’s maintenance claims to what you see in person: entryways, mail/package areas, and how quickly requests get acknowledged.
  • Open-violation signals can lag real-world conditions. Use them as a starting point, then request the latest status or documentation from management.
  • If a building is near transit, double-check noise and ventilation (street-facing units, HVAC placement, and common-area traffic) during your visit.
